MONTREAL: Mexican driver Sergio Perez was given the green light to race in tomorrow’s Canadian Formula One Grand Prix after passing a medical examination test. The rookie missed the May 29 Monaco Grand Prix after crashing heavily into the barriers at the tunnel exit in the final qualifying session and being taken to hospital with bruises and concussion. The governing body, however, said in a statement that Perez had been passed fit. “I just went to do the examination and all the tests again with the FIA, and everything was fine,” said Perez.
